Cold War and Kill Switch are useless. Spec those points into Escalation(Criticial hit damage bonus) and Rolling Thunder(Wolf Damage increase) instead.
Do you have a level 70 celestial enforcer class mod? If so, use it instead, you are missing out on more points you can use.

Firstly, Cold War isn’t as great as it sounds on paper. The chance to freeze is based off of the gun’s DoT chance, so the 25% chance to freeze your target is based off a 0-20% chance for most guns, making the effect proc far less often than you would imagine (I think I’ve seen 2-3% chance to actually freeze). Using cryo weapons will make freezing enemies far easier than relying on Cold War.
Also, I understand that FtF isn’t everyone’s cup of tea (I barely ever use it myself) but one point in Laser Focus won’t do anything for you, and FtF is boosted by your COM. It’ll give you a 48% damage increase at the start of every encounter, which is nothing to sneeze. It’s Wilhelm’s largest damage skill, so you should really take it.
This is a personal pet peeve, but I don’t usually take Auxillary Tanks when I have Laser Guided. W&S duration will be super long anyway, so I’d rather put those points into Fortify for more damage.
Lastly, since you’re using the Howitzer, you should take Escalation and Power Fist, since crit, explosive, and melee damage is buffed by cryo.

i highly suggest you dump the Howitizer mod for a Chronicler of Elpis mod for an explosive build, as the CoE benefits more the cryo/freeze -> explosive strategy and damage on UVHM
